FAKE TAXI DRIVER: Unlicensed driver fined nearly £2,000 for multiple offences

Updated: Sep 4, 2023



A woman from Caerphilly has been ordered to pay a hefty fine of almost £2,000 after being caught operating as an unlicensed taxi driver on three separate occasions.


Danielle Helen Buckley, aged 43, was prosecuted by the council's trading standards team following an extensive investigation.

As reported by the South Wales Argus, Cwmbran Magistrates' Court heard how Buckley was apprehended while driving a Kia Ceed in Pontlottyn and Tir-Y-Berth between the dates of 17-20 January. The defendant later pleaded guilty to three counts of acting as a hackney carriage driver without a licence.

The court imposed a fine of £500 on Buckley. In addition to the fine, she has also been ordered to pay £1,255 in costs, along with a £200 surcharge.
